Found this while debugging why node four kept flagging packages the others ignored. Turns out someone hand-edited the similarity threshold on that box months ago and it never got reverted — classic drift. The typo-squatting scanner is supposed to run identical settings fleet-wide, otherwise our registry alerts for Fernhollow's mirror get inconsistent and nobody trusts them. I've reconciled everything against the source-of-truth repo and redeployed. For future maintainers, the canonical scanner configuration is reproduced below.

config for kawif-hahig:
zorix:
  log_level: error
  metrics_host: metrics.zorix.lumiclabs.internal
  pool_size: 16

### Account Recovery — Catalogue Import (Lintwood)

Quick one for review: when the Lintwood catalogue import wipes a patron's session table, the recovery flow re-seeds accounts from the nightly snapshot. Check that the importer skips locked accounts — last time it didn't. To rerun recovery against staging you'll need the vault passphrase, which is appended just below.

recovery phrase for yafof-tajof: julmir-kelax-julvan-holath-belvan-holir-ralael-ralvan-ralath-julvan-silmir-istmir-kaswyn-ulamir

Changed defaults in Splitfork, our assignment service. Bucketing now uses sticky hashing per account instead of per session, and the holdout slice grew from 2% to 5%. Callers relying on session-level reassignment must opt in explicitly. Review the diff against the new baseline; the updated default configuration is listed below.

config for tagep-kajof:
[casir]
port = 6379
region = south-1
host = casir.paliqdyn.example
team = tamax
timeout_ms = 250
retries = 2

Meeting notes — Metrology stores catch-up, item 4

Quick update on the calibration weights: the batch from Dellquist Instruments cleared inspection and Marja signed off the certificates this morning. Records team, please file the certs under the usual series before Friday. The weights themselves go back out to the Ashfell lab next week by courier, foam-packed as always. Jot this down for the hand-over itself.

courier memo of bajop-kagep: the norwyn wenath courier leaves the keliel jorath wenmir ledger at gate 9298 under passcode 241279